Introduction to Personalized Medicine

Personalized medicine represents a revolutionary shift in healthcare, moving away from a one-size-fits-all approach to treatments that are tailored to the individual's unique genetic makeup. For American males, this advancement is particularly relevant in the realm of testosterone therapy, where genetic variations can significantly influence treatment outcomes.

Understanding Testosterone and Its Importance

Testosterone is a crucial hormone in males, responsible for regulating a variety of bodily functions, including muscle mass, bone density, and sexual health. As men age, testosterone levels naturally decline, which can lead to symptoms such as fatigue, decreased libido, and mood changes. Traditional testosterone replacement therapy (TRT) has been a common solution, but its effectiveness can vary widely among individuals.

The Role of Genetics in Testosterone Therapy

Recent advances in genomics have revealed that genetic variations can affect how individuals respond to TRT. For instance, polymorphisms in genes such as the androgen receptor (AR) gene can influence the sensitivity of tissues to testosterone. Men with certain AR gene variants may require different dosages or formulations of testosterone to achieve optimal results.

Tailoring Therapy Based on Genetic Profiles

By analyzing a patient's DNA, healthcare providers can identify specific genetic markers that influence testosterone metabolism and receptor sensitivity. This information allows for the customization of TRT regimens, optimizing both efficacy and safety. For example, a man with a genetic predisposition to metabolize testosterone quickly might benefit from a sustained-release formulation, while another with heightened receptor sensitivity might require a lower dose to avoid side effects.

Benefits of Personalized Testosterone Therapy

Personalized testosterone therapy offers several advantages over traditional approaches. Firstly, it can enhance treatment efficacy by ensuring that the therapy is precisely matched to the patient's biological needs. Secondly, it can reduce the risk of adverse effects by minimizing the likelihood of over- or under-dosing. Finally, it can improve patient satisfaction and adherence to treatment, as individuals are more likely to experience positive outcomes.

Implementing Personalized Medicine in Clinical Practice

To integrate personalized medicine into testosterone therapy, healthcare providers must first conduct a comprehensive genetic analysis of their patients. This involves collecting a DNA sample, typically through a simple cheek swab, and sending it to a specialized laboratory for analysis. The results are then used to develop a tailored treatment plan, which is continuously monitored and adjusted as needed.

Challenges and Considerations

Despite its potential, personalized testosterone therapy faces several challenges. The cost of genetic testing and the need for specialized expertise can be barriers to widespread adoption. Additionally, the field is still evolving, and more research is needed to fully understand the impact of genetic variations on TRT. However, as technology advances and costs decrease, personalized medicine is likely to become increasingly accessible to American males seeking optimal testosterone therapy.
